For this week's challenge we are using Cricut Wrap It Up cartridge and are flaunting the castle on page 24. I do not have that cartridge, but I found a cute castle on  page 22 on Life's A Party cartridge. The handbook shows the castle in red and purple---now is that my sign! I always need cards for friends in the Red Hat Society and we love being queens! I cut the castle using the card feature at 10 inches. This results in a large card with the finished size being 4 1/2 x 10 at the highest point. Every queen wants a large castle!!
Royal wishes which is found on page 56 on Birthday Bash is cut at 2 1/2 inches.
Cuttlebug folders: Moroccan Screen - door, Swiss dots on the red tower pieces.
I randomly placed the punched crowns. These cuts were given to me by a friend. To add bling, I added lots of Recollection gemstones. Inside the card, I used the phrase Happy Birthday from Birthday Bash cut at 4 inches.
